Chaparro
MEET CHAPARRO
Currently Fostered in: Loreto, Baja California Sur, Mexico
Ready for adoption & travel
Chaparro first appeared outside a home in Loreto during the intense heat of September 2024, looking exhausted and thirsty. The family began leaving him water and shade, then food, baths, parasite prevention, vaccines and veterinary care. Soon, Chaparro started coming back every day and even brought another dog with him — Rocky. They later discovered that Rocky and Chaparro are actually brothers from the same litter.

About Chaparro:
Male
Approx. 4 years old
Approx. 25 kg / 55 lbs
Baja Mix (possible Lab mix)
Neutered
Vaccinated
Dewormed & protected against fleas/ticks
Chaparro has basically chosen this family as his safe place. He spends much of his day with them, joins their walks and loves being part of everything, but what he still needs is a forever home officially his own.
Sweet, loyal & affectionate
Very social with other dogs
Good with children with normal supervision
Friendly with people
NOT cat-friendly
Medium-high energy
Walks very well on leash
Loves walks, chasing games & balls
Enjoys both indoor and outdoor time
Independent with no separation anxiety
Knows several basic commands
Usually only barks when necessary
Chaparro has had some seasonal skin allergies during the hot weather, which have been managed with veterinary care.
He would love a home where he can enjoy regular walks, outdoor time, affection and companionship.
For a long time, Chaparro has kept choosing the people who showed him kindness. Now we hope someone will finally choose him.
